《计算机网络原理与技术 第2版》PDF下载

  • 购买积分:14 如何计算积分?
  • 作  者:刘化君编著
  • 出 版 社:北京:电子工业出版社
  • 出版年份:2012
  • ISBN:9787121170867
  • 页数:446 页
图书介绍:本书系统地介绍了计算机网络工作原理、协议及其实现技术。全书由10章组成,在概述计算机网络基本概念、基本理论问题的基础上,主要讨论了数据通信基础、数据链路控制、局域网、网络互连及其协议、路由技术、网络传输服务、网络应用、多媒体通信网及网络性能分析评价等内容,反映了当前计算机网络领域的新技术和理论成果。为帮助读者掌握基础理论知识,每章附有小结、思考与练习题。

第1章 绪论 1

1.1计算机网络的诞生与发展 1

1.1.1计算机网络的诞生 1

1.1.2计算机网络的发展 2

1.1.3计算机网络发展趋势 11

1.2计算机网络的基本概念 14

1.2.1计算机网络的定义 15

1.2.2计算机网络的主要功能 16

1.2.3计算机网络的分类 18

1.3计算机网络的组成 21

1.3.1计算机网络的组成结构 21

1.3.2计算机网络的拓扑结构 22

1.3.3计算机网络系统的组成 24

1.4计算机网络的体系结构 28

1.4.1网络体系结构的分层 29

1.4.2 ISO/OSI参考模型 31

1.4.3 TCP/IP协议体系 37

1.4.4基于OSI的实用参考模型 41

1.4.5计算机网络标准及RFC文档 43

1.5计算机网络的基本理论问题 45

本章小结 46

思考与练习 46

第2章 数据通信基础 48

2.1数据通信的理论基础 48

2.1.1数据通信的基本概念 48

2.1.2傅里叶分析与有限带宽信号 53

2.2数据编码技术 55

2.2.1模拟信号传输模拟数据 55

2.2.2模拟信号传输数字数据 56

2.2.3数字信号传输数字数据 57

2.2.4数字信号传输模拟数据 60

2.3数据传输方式 61

2.3.1数据通信方式 61

2.3.2数据同步方式 63

2.4传输媒体 64

2.4.1导向传输媒体 65

2.4.2非导向传输媒体 67

2.5多路复用技术 72

2.5.1频分多路复用 72

2.5.2时分多路复用 73

2.5.3波分多路复用 75

2.5.4码分多址访问 76

2.6数据交换技术 79

2.6.1电路交换 79

2.6.2存储转发交换 80

2.6.3光交换 83

2.7物理层协议及标准 85

2.7.1物理层接口的四种特性 85

2.7.2物理层接口标准示例 87

2.7.3数据传输质量参数 93

本章小结 95

思考与练习 95

第3章 数据链路控制 97

3.1数据链路层的基本概念 97

3.1.1数据链路层的功能 97

3.1.2数据链路层提供的服务 98

3.2帧与帧同步技术 99

3.2.1帧的基本格式 99

3.2.2帧同步方法 100

3.2.3通用组帧规程 102

3.3差错检测和纠错技术 103

3.3.1奇偶校验 103

3.3.2汉明码 104

3.3.3循环冗余校验 106

3.3.4校验和 107

3.4数据链路控制机制 109

3.4.1滑动窗口机制 110

3.4.2停止等待式ARQ协议 112

3.4.3后退N帧式ARQ协议 117

3.4.4选择重传式ARQ协议 118

3.5高级数据链路控制 120

3.5.1 HDLC的基本概念 120

3.5.2 HDLC的帧格式 122

3.5.3 HDLC帧的类型及功能 124

3.6因特网数据链路接入控制 127

3.6.1 PPP协议概述 127

3.6.2 PPP协议的帧格式 129

3.6.3 PPP链路的控制过程 130

本章小结 130

思考与练习 131

第4章 局域网 133

4.1局域网体系结构 133

4.1.1局域网的基本概念 133

4.1.2 IEEE 802局域网标准系列 134

4.1.3 IEEE 802局域网的体系结构 136

4.2以太网工作原理 140

4.2.1介质访问控制方法 140

4.2.2 CSMA/CD协议 141

4.2.3以太网帧格式及数据封装 146

4.3以太网技术 148

4.3.1传统以太网 148

4.3.2快速以太网 154

4.3.3千兆以太网 158

4.3.4万兆以太网 162

4.4虚拟局域网 166

4.4.1虚拟局域网的基本概念 166

4.4.2虚拟局域网的帧格式 167

4.4.3虚拟局域网的实现技术 168

4.5无线局域网(WLAN) 169

4.5.1 WLAN和无线链路特征 169

4.5.2 WLAN标准 171

4.5.3 IEEE 802.11帧结构 173

4.5.4 IEEE 802.11 MAC协议 175

4.5.5 WLAN组网设备 178

4.5.6 WLAN组网实例 180

本章小结 181

思考与练习 181

第5章 网络互连及其协议 183

5.1网络互连概述 183

5.1.1何谓网络互连 183

5.1.2网络互连的类型及层次 186

5.1.3网络互连设备 188

5.1.4网络层服务模型 191

5.2网际互联协议(IPv4) 192

5.2.1 IPv4数据报格式 192

5.2.2 IPv4地址 197

5.2.3子网和超网 200

5.2.4无分类域间路由 205

5.2.5地址解析 208

5.3差错报告和控制机制 211

5.3.1 ICMP报文格式 212

5.3.2 ICMP差错报告报文 213

5.3.3 ICMP查询报文 215

5.3.4 ICMP协议应用示例 217

5.4 IP数据报转发 217

5.4.1 IP数据报转发处理过程 218

5.4.2 IP路由表 219

5.4.3 IP数据报转发算法 221

5.5 IP组播和IGMP 224

5.5.1 IP组播 225

5.5.2 Internet组管理协议 227

5.6 IPv6 230

5.6.1 IPv6编址 230

5.6.2 IPv6数据报格式 235

5.6.3从IPv4向IPv6的过渡 238

5.7移动IP技术 240

5.7.1移动IPv4 240

5.7.2移动IPv6 243

本章小结 245

思考与练习 246

第6章 路由技术基础 248

6.1路由的基本概念 248

6.1.1何谓路由 248

6.1.2静态路由 249

6.1.3动态路由 251

6.2路由选择算法 253

6.2.1距离向量路由算法 253

6.2.2链路状态路由算法 255

6.2.3 Internet路由协议 257

6.3路由信息协议 259

6.4开放最短路径优先(OSPF)协议 261

6.5边界网关协议 266

6.6路由器配置基础 269

6.6.1路由器配置环境的准备 270

6.6.2路由器配置模式 272

6.6.3 IOS命令行接口简介 274

6.6.4路由器常用配置 277

6.6.5路由器配置示例 281

本章小结 285

思考与练习 286

第7章 网络传输服务 288

7.1传输层概述 288

7.1.1传输层的地位 288

7.1.2传输层的基本功能 289

7.1.3传输层提供的服务 290

7.2进程间通信 293

7.2.1端口及其作用 294

7.2.2传输层的复用与解复用 297

7.3传输控制协议 300

7.3.1 TCP协议概述 300

7.3.2 TCP报文格式 303

7.3.3 TCP连接管理 307

7.3.4 TCP流量控制 311

7.3.5 TCP定时管理 313

7.3.6 TCP拥塞控制 315

7.4用户数据报协议 319

7.4.1 UDP协议概述 319

7.4.2 UDP数据报格式 319

7.4.3 UDP校验和 320

7.5协议分析器与协议分析 321

7.5.1协议分析器及应用 321

7.5.2 TCP协议实例分析 324

本章小结 326

思考与练习 327

第8章 网络应用及其协议 329

8.1网络应用概述 329

8.1.1应用层的地位和作用 329

8.1.2应用层协议 330

8.1.3网络应用模式 331

8.2 Web服务与HTTP协议 334

8.2.1 Web服务工作原理 335

8.2.2统一资源定位器 337

8.2.3 Web页及其设计 339

8.2.4超文本传输协议 342

8.3文件传输与远程文件访问 351

8.3.1文件传输协议 351

8.3.2简单文件传输协议 354

8.3.3网络文件系统 355

8.4电子邮件及其传输 356

8.4.1电子邮件系统 356

8.4.2电子邮件报文格式和MINE 359

8.4.3 SMTP邮件传输 362

8.4.4邮件读取协议 364

8.5域名系统 367

8.5.1 Internet域名结构 367

8.5.2 DNS的工作机制 369

8.6动态主机配置协议 374

8.6.1 DHCP概述 374

8.6.2 DHCP工作原理 375

本章小结 377

思考与练习 378

第9章 多媒体通信网 379

9.1多媒体通信概述 379

9.1.1何谓多媒体通信 379

9.1.2多媒体通信关键技术 381

9.1.3多媒体通信协议体系 385

9.2多媒体通信网简介 386

9.3多媒体通信协议 390

9.3.1实时传输协议 390

9.3.2实时传输控制协议 392

9.3.3实时流式协议 393

9.4 IP电话 394

9.4.1 IP电话简介 394

9.4.2 H.323协议 395

9.4.3会话起始协议 398

9.5流控制传输协议 403

9.5.1 SCTP的功能特性 403

9.5.2 SCTP协议数据包结构 405

9.5.3 SCTP关联 411

9.5.4 SCTP协议应用 414

本章小结 416

思考与练习 417

第10章 网络性能分析与评价 419

10.1计算机网络中的数学问题 419

10.1.1随机过程 419

10.1.2排队论 421

10.1.3图论 424

10.2网络性能的测量与评价 426

10.2.1网络性能测评的目的及准则 426

10.2.2网络性能测量指标 429

10.2.3网络性能测量的工具与方法 431

10.2.4网络系统的性能分析与评价 432

10.3计算机网络仿真 434

10.3.1网络仿真软件 434

10.3.2 NS-3网络仿真系统软件 436

10.3.3基于Ubuntu平台的NS-3的安装与运行 441

10.3.4 NS-3仿真脚本示例 443

本章小结 445

思考与练习 445

参考文献 446